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Age over 18 years and under 65 years Grade 2 (moderate) ligament injury based on clinical and imaging criteria absence of ankle fracture presented within the first 72 hours after the injury
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Pregnancy Breastfeeding Those who intend to become pregnant Radiologic evidence of fracture or damage to syndesmosis at presentation history of previous sprain or fracture in each of ankles History of surgery and active infection at the site of injury History of peripheral vascular diseases Foot deformities Knee or ankle osteoarthritis Rheumatoid Arthritis Ankylosing spondylitis Diabetes Mellitus Neurological disorders Psychiatric disorders
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Determination of ankle pain with VAS. Timepoint: At first visit, one month after injury, three months after injury. Method of measurement: Questionnaire (Visual Analogue Scale).;Determination of ankle function with AOFAS. Timepoint: At first visit, one month after injury, three months after injury. Method of measurement: Questionnaire (American Orthopedic Foot and Ankle Score). | — |
